This month I kept my journal spread pretty simple. Sometimes it’s harder to get started when you have to set up your art space. Gathering all your paints, stamps, and embellishments can be quiet a lot of work in itself making you not want to journal at all.
What’s great about this spread is you can sit on your couch, thumb through some old magazines, ripping pages out as you go and simply paste images down with your glue stick. Easy Peasy!
Below is a list of the supplies I used to create this journal spread. Have fun exploring January’s journal prompt. Get as artsy as you want. And share your work with me in the comments!
